M79.675  – Pain in left toe(s)

M79.675 – Pain in left toe(s)

The ICD Code M79.675 diagnoses pain in the left toe(s). Read this guide to discover the code’s clinical information, synonyms, and similar codes.

Yes, various forms of arthritis, such as osteoarthritis or rheumatoid arthritis, can cause pain in the left toe(s) due to joint inflammation and degeneration.

Treatment options for pain in the left toe(s) depend on the underlying cause and may include pain management, physical therapy, medication, orthotics, or, in some cases, surgery.

It is advisable to consult a healthcare professional if the pain in your left toe(s) is persistent, severe, or accompanied by redness, swelling, or difficulty walking. Proper evaluation is necessary for an accurate diagnosis and appropriate treatment.
